#397c58 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#397c58 is composed of 22.4% red, 48.6%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 54% cyan, 0% magenta, 29% yellow and 51.4% black. It has a hue angle of 147.8 degrees, a saturation of 37% and a lightness of 35.5%. #397c58 color hex could be obtained by blending #72f8b0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336666.

#397c58 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#397c58 has RGB values of R:57, G:124, B:88 and CMYK values of C:0.54, M:0, Y:0.29, K:0.51. Its decimal value is 3767384.

Shades and Tints of #397c58
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010302 is the darkest color, while #f5faf7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#397c58
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#55605a is the less saturated color, while #01b454 is the most saturated one.
